Is there a reason that we can't export Voice Notes to the desktop or email?

I'm using Voice Notes to record some audio that I want to send on to someone and there doesn't seem to be a sensible way of getting the audio out of the app. I had to go into Services and Open it in iTunes for it to be available to me.


This seems wildly silly.

Click on the recording entry in Voice Memos and drag and drop right into the body of a Mail compose window. It will attach as a .m4a audio file. You can also drag and drop into the Messages application where it attaches and waits for additional input from you.


Tested: macOS 14.3
